New model: Hillbilly Bush Tool. These are both spear point. I may do some 0 drop in the future, but this is what I had handy.

$125 each shipped, insured and PP G&S

Both are 1/8" 80crv2. Forge scale flats, scandi grind. Grip finish micata scales with micarta pins and tubes.

Around 3 7/8" blade, 8 1/4" overall.

I began making PL knives 4 years ago. I've done leather work for around 20. I added kydex to my repertoire in the last 2 years. The heat treat on all of my carbon steel knives is done by me in a thermostatically controlled Evenheat knifemaking kiln. Each blade goes through a 3 stage normalization process, followed by heating to austenitic temperature and quench in Parks 50 oil. Then it goes through a 2 stage tempering process. Target hardness is 60 rhc. Scales are glued with West Systems G-flex epoxy.
